Legality

CBD is a cannabinoid growing in popularity in the world of health. It is extracted from the cannabis, but does not contain the psychoactive ingredient tetrahydrocannabinol(THC) that can cause people to feel high after using marijuana. Unlike THC, CBD isn't addictive and doesn't have any negative effects. Scientists are still learning about CBD's effects. However, some believe it has analgesic and pain-reducing properties. It can also reduce inflammation and fight free radicals. CBD is typically used in the form of oil. The oil can be consumed orally or applied to the skin. It can also be added to food items or drinks. It is important to read the label before purchasing CBD products. Certain companies test only for CBD and THC while others are more thorough.

It is important to select an organization that makes their lab reports available. This will allow you to determine whether the business is trustworthy. It is also advisable to select a company that tests for mycotoxins as well as heavy metals. This will ensure that you get the best possible product.

The CBD market in the UK has seen rapid growth and the number of consumers is increasing. However, many people are unsure of which products are legal. There is a huge amount of misinformation on the internet and social media regarding what is and what isn't legal in the UK. This confusion is due in part to the fact that current legislation surrounding consumer CBD products is complex and difficult to comprehend.

CBD products sold in the UK must not contain THC. THC is the ingredient that gives you the high in the cannabis plant, however it must be extremely low for CBD products to be sold legally. THC-free CBD products can be purchased at most pharmacies, but you should always do your research prior to buying.

CBD is derived from cannabis, but it doesn't contain any psychoactive ingredients. CBD is currently classified as a controlled substance in the UK. However, it can be sold provided certain conditions are satisfied. The UK's Medicines and Healthcare Products Regulatory Agency is reviewing the regulation of CBD to determine how CBD can be used in a safe manner in the UK. The MHRA hopes to release the report by the end of 2021.

Dosage

The dosage of CBD required to get the desired effects will differ from person to person based on their body's chemistry and weight. A general rule is to begin small and gradually increase your dosage until you get the desired results. The best method to accomplish this is to keep track of your progress using an app for your smartphone or journal. You can record your daily intake and determine what the ideal amount is for you.

Once you have figured out your ideal dosage, it's essential to adhere to the recommended daily dosage. This will ensure you get the most benefits while minimizing any adverse effects. It could take several weeks before you feel effects, but remember to be patient!

The form of CBD you select will affect the speed at which it takes effect. Gummies and capsules usually contain an amount of mg of CBD per dose, making it easier to determine the right dose. CBD oil and sprays are typically supplied preloaded in syringes to allow you to easily dispensing the correct amount without having to take the lid off.

For some, the most effective dosage is as little as 5 mg of CBD a day. The best way to determine the ideal dosage is to track your progress and increase it slowly as time passes. This allows you to fine tune your CBD intake until you have found the perfect balance of benefits and adverse effects.

Side effects

CBD is a part of your body's natural endocannabinoid system, which helps keep you well-balanced and regulates things such as mood, sleep patterns and appetite. CBD can also help to reduce the symptoms of a variety of conditions, such as anxiety disorders and pain. It may also help reduce seizures that are caused by certain types of epilepsy. It can also help alleviate nausea and vomiting, which are commonly caused by cancer treatments as well as other diseases. click the next webpage helps reduce muscle spasticity in those with MS and decrease inflammation associated with arthritis and other rheumatic illnesses.

CBD oil's use to combat chronic pain is currently being studied with promising results. For instance, a research study that followed the experiences of more than 100 individuals with fibromyalgia found that those who used CBD oil had less symptoms and had a better quality of life than those who took a placebo (10).

While some research suggests CBD may reduce pain itself, it appears to be most effective when used in combination with THC (a component found in cannabis). In the UK there is a spray that has both THC (a component of cannabis) and CBD known as Sativex is approved to treat the numbness and spasticity associated with MS (12). Other studies have demonstrated that CBD can aid in relieving the pain and fatigue that are associated with rheumatic disorders like fibromyalgia (13) and help ease anxiety and stress that can trigger depression in people with bipolar disorder (24) and schizophrenia.

CBD is generally safe for the majority of users, however you must always verify the ingredients prior to making use of any product. If it contains more than trace amounts of THC which is the chemical that produces the psychoactive effects of cannabis you should stay clear of it. It can also interfere negatively with certain medications. These include benzodiazepine sedatives such as Klonopin, Ativan (clonazepam), immune suppressants such as Cytosar (cyclosporine) and Sandimmune(azathioprine), and anti-TB drugs like rifampin. It's advisable to talk to your doctor prior to taking any new supplement, especially if you are taking other medications.
